AUDIT.

 

No. 29 of 1954.

An Act to amend the Audit Act 1901-1953, and for other purposes.

[Assented to 24th September, 1954.]

BE it enacted by the Queen’s Most Excellent Majesty, the Senate, and the House of Representatives of the Commonwealth of Australia, for the purpose of appropriating the grant originated in the House of Representatives, as follows:—

Short title and citation.

1.—(1.)   This Act may be cited as the Audit Act 1954.

(2.)  The Audit Act 1901-1953 is in this Act referred to as the Principal Act.


 

(3.)  The Principal Act, as amended by this Act, may be cited as the Audit Act 1901-1954.

Commencement.

2.—(1.)   Section three of this Act shall be deemed to have come into operation on the first day of July, One thousand nine hundred and fifty-three.

(2.)  The remaining provisions of this Act shall be deemed to have come into operation on the twenty-fifth day of September, One thousand nine hundred and fifty-four.

Salary of Auditor-General.

3.    Section four of the Principal Act is amended by omitting the words “Three thousand three hundred and fifty pounds” and inserting in their stead the words “Three thousand five hundred pounds”.

Extension of term of office of Auditor-General.

4.    Notwithstanding the provisions of section five a of the Audit Act 1901-1954 but subject to the other provisions of that Act, the Auditor-General for the Commonwealth holding office at the date of commencement of this section shall continue in his office for a period of one year from and including the twenty-sixth day of September, One thousand nine hundred and fifty-four, being the date upon which the Auditor-General will attain the age of sixty-five years.
